4PH3-1000 Phosphine Electrochemical Sensor 
(P/N: SEC-4PH3-1000)

 
 
Technical Specifications
MEASUREMENT 
Operating Principle3-electrode electrochemical
Detection Range0~1000 ppm
Sensitivity0.07 ± 0.0.05μA /ppm
Response Time (T90)25s
Repeatability<±2% signal
LinearityLinear 
Maximum Overload<2% signal/month
ELECTRICAL
Resolution1 ppm
Recommended Load5~30 
Bias Voltage0mV
ENVIRONMENTAL
Operating Temp. Range-20°C ~ 50°C
Operating Humidity Range15% RH ~ 90% RH non- condensing
Operating Pressure Range800 ~ 1200 mbar
LIFETIME
Recommended Storage Temp.0°C to +20°C in sealed container
Expected Operating Life24 months in air
Storage Life6 months in original packaging
Standard Warranty12 months

Whilst the Gas Sensor are designed to be highly specific to the gas they are intended to measure, they will still respond to some degree to various gases. The table below is not exclusive and other gases not included in the table may still cause a sensor to react. The cross-sensitivity values quoted are based on tests conducted on a small number of sensors. They are intended to indicate sensor response to gases other than the target gas. Sensors may behave differently with changes in ambient conditions and any batch may show significant variation from the values quoted.
SAFETY NOTE:
Connection should be made via a PCB mounting socket. Soldering to pins will void the sensor's warranty.
It is important that exposure to high concentrations of solvent vapours is avoided, both during storage, fitting into instruments, and operation;
If the Gas Sensor is removed from application circuit, a jumper should be added on 'R' and 'S' pin.
